Permits Filed for 585 Jackson Avenue in Melrose, The Bronx

 


Permits have been filed for a nine-story mixed-use building at 585 Jackson Avenue in Melrose, The Bronx. Located between East 149th Street and East 152nd Street, the lot is one block south of the Jackson Avenue subway station, served by the 2 and 5 trains. Yosef Beer is listed as the owner behind the applications.

The proposed 84-foot-tall development will yield 63,659 square feet, with 63,374 square feet designated for residential space and 285 square feet for commercial space. The building will have 80 residences, most likely condos based on the average unit scope of 792 square feet. The masonry-based structure will also have a 30-foot-long rear yard, 16 open parking spaces, and four enclosed parking spaces.

Nikolai Katz Architect is listed as the architect of record.

Demolition permits were filed in February for the two-story structure on the property. An estimated completion date has not been announced.
